Output 45b35b924fe3c71c83465140f9890f8d5238a67b236c710a5163bce57370185a:1

value
168613337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1620d6cddb592d53d5fe39312b41c6a455123de7 OP_EQUAL
address
33i28TpUsWGjhcodYUqBzP7fGDANSQwfWg
transaction
45b35b924fe3c71c83465140f9890f8d5238a67b236c710a5163bce57370185a
confirmations
508665
spent
true